Skip to content
This repository was archived by the owner on Jun 5, 2025. It is now read-only.

Disable suspicious commands for now #1204

Merged
merged 3 commits into from
Mar 4, 2025
Merged
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
20 changes: 10 additions & 10 deletions src/codegate/pipeline/comment/output.py
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,6 @@
)
from codegate.pipeline.base import PipelineContext
from codegate.pipeline.output import OutputPipelineContext, OutputPipelineStep
from codegate.pipeline.suspicious_commands.suspicious_commands import check_suspicious_code
from codegate.storage import StorageEngine
from codegate.utils.package_extractor import PackageExtractor

Expand Down Expand Up @@ -52,15 +51,16 @@ async def _snippet_comment(self, snippet: CodeSnippet, context: PipelineContext)
"""Create a comment for a snippet"""
comment = ""

if (
snippet.filepath is None
and snippet.file_extension is None
and "filepath" not in snippet.code
and "existing code" not in snippet.code
):
new_comment, is_suspicious = await check_suspicious_code(snippet.code, snippet.language)
if is_suspicious:
comment += new_comment
# if (
# snippet.filepath is None
# and snippet.file_extension is None
# and "filepath" not in snippet.code
# and "existing code" not in snippet.code
# ):
# new_comment, is_suspicious = await check_suspicious_code(snippet.code,
# snippet.language)
# if is_suspicious:
# comment += new_comment

snippet.libraries = PackageExtractor.extract_packages(snippet.code, snippet.language)

Expand Down